Small redcurrant jam with seeds removed by hand using a goose quill. A refined local specialty of Bar-le-Duc long prized in Lorraine.
Quiche from nearby Lorraine made with cream, eggs, and bacon in pastry. It is a regional staple commonly eaten in Bar-le-Duc.
A rich pie of pork and veal baked in pastry, often seasoned with Lorraine flavors. This hearty dish is traditional in the wider Meuse area.

Moderate for France. Hotels, dining, and local transport are usually cheaper than in Paris or major tourist cities, but costs are still above budget destinations.
Service is usually included. Round up or leave 5-10% for great restaurant service. Taxis can be rounded up. Small change is enough in cafes.
